I do not have experience with the Dewalt/Makita/or Festool router's DC. I do have experience with 2 other brands DC arrangement and it was so horrible that it was useless, maybe even dangerous since the vac hose connected to the router made things quite unhandy (I guess the Dewalt setup helps with this). I've read a few posts about the Festool, and most claim it works no better. My opinion is that the router is one of those tools that would be very hard to tame when making a blind cut like a dado. Long ago I started routing MDF only when I can do it outside. The only thing this does is clear dust well (on a windy day) and keeps it out of the shop. I hope someone else chimes in; but I fear you're after the holy grail.
